DEYE 8Kw Inverter BMS settings

Featured Replies

HI All

I have a 8kw Deye inverter, 14 x JA 550w panels and 3 x Deyness 5,12 kw batteries.

I have set my Battery Capacity at 300Ah, Max A Charge and Discharge at 150A based on research.

With these settings and Batt Mode on Lithium I get a charge of approx 2,66Kw on a good sunny day from my panels ( I understand this to be managed by the BMS)

When I change my Batt Mode to 'use batt V' or Use batt %' the battery charge20250817_114320.jpg rate alomost doubles to abot 5-6Kw.

Why does the setting ubnder lithium charge so slowly? How could I get the batteries to charge faster with BMS?

When to Use it

You should only use the "Active Battery" function in a situation where your lithium-ion battery is completely discharged, the BMS has shut down, and the inverter is unable to charge it.

Important Safety Note: This is a last-resort tool for a very specific problem. It should not be used in normal operation. Leaving it enabled could potentially bypass certain safety checks and is not recommended. Once the battery has been successfully "woken up" and is charging normally, you should disable the "Active Battery" setting again.

On a Deye inverter's Li BMS screen, communication with three Dyness batteries in parallel is indicated by the total capacity and current rating in your case charge current limit 150A and discharge current 150A. You should see the total rated discharge current for three batteries (e.g., 150A for three 50A batteries), not just one, and the listed total capacity should be three times the individual battery's capacity. If you only see a single battery's capacity and a lower discharge limit, it indicates a communication failure or incorrect wiring between the master battery and the slave batteries.

Below screenshot of a single Dyness battery on the Li bms screen.

I'm assuming your 3 batteries are interconnected, data wise and connected to the inverter, but it seems the 50A Limits apply to one battery and this could be an inverter firmware problem, or a battery firmware problem... for now, I suggest you use batt V mode, with a charge Voltage of 56.5V and a current limit of 150A...

I had exactly the same problem with my 8KW Deye and 3 batteries topping out at 50Amp charge rate, Last week I restarted the batteries and the inverter and my issue went away now charging much faster not sure what caused this.

You could also check the dip switch settings on the batteries. Someone in a previous thread had the issue that the dip switches were wrong, so the batteries were not set up correctly as master and slave(s).

I would check this first before changing the wiring on the batteries, considering that you say it works fine as expected when the inverter is operating in Voltage mode.

The issue is, the inverter can only "see" one of your batteries via the BMS.

Ok, so. talk to supplier, I'd suggest, since there is obviously a problem somewhere, whether its with the comms cabling between the batteries or the settings on the batteries themselves (dip switches, I assume) or a "feature" in either the batteries' or the Inverters firmware, it needs to be identified and fixed, so you can have your guarantee honoured, but just as an aside... if you set the charging Voltage to that which the BMS told the inverter... see your screenshot... 56.5V, then the current accepted by the batteries for charging is still under the BMS control, it will not, for instance, allow 200A per battery to flow, even if it were to be available, so in the short term, there certainly should be no harm that could come to your batteries, until the real problem is eliminated and then you can use Lithium battery type without any problems, I'd hope.

Problem solved. I did a Firmware update on the Deye inverter. That did not help and the problem remained.

I then called Deyness and they inspected the network cables being used. They advised me to change the cables and that did the trick.

150A charge and discharge. Solar panels are working and producing and storing at the optimuim with Batt set to Lithium.
